Redesigning N-glycosylation sites in a GH3 β-xylosidase improves the enzymatic efficiency.

Marcelo Ventura RubioCésar Rafael Fanchini TerrasanFabiano Jares ContesiniMariane Paludetti ZubietaJaqueline Aline GerhardtLeandro Cristante OliveiraAny Elisa de Souza Schmidt GonçalvesFausto AlmeidaBradley Joseph SmithGustavo Henrique Martins Ferreira de SouzaArtur Hermano Sampaio DiasMunir SkafAndré Ricardo de Lima Damasio
Published in: Biotechnology for biofuels (2019)
This study demonstrates the influence of N-glycosylation on A. nidulans BxlB production and function, reinforcing that protein glycoengineering is a promising tool for enhancing thermal stability, secretion, and enzymatic activity. Our report may also support biotechnological applications for N-glycosylation modification of other CAZymes.
